How Foreigners can Start a Business in Oman?

 

How Foreigners can Start a Business in Oman?. Starting a business in Oman as a foreigner is a great opportunity due to the country’s strong economy and investor-friendly policies. However, understanding the legal process is crucial for a smooth setup.

First, you need to choose a business structure. The most common options are a Limited Liability Company (LLC) or a branch office. Foreign investors often require an Omani partner holding at least 30% ownership in an LLC, but 100% foreign ownership is possible in free zones.

Next, register your company with the Ministry of Commerce, Industry, and Investment Promotion (MOCIIP). You must obtain a commercial registration certificate, a tax certificate, and necessary licenses depending on your business activity.

Additionally, setting up a corporate bank account and leasing an office space are mandatory steps. The government also requires foreign businesses to comply with Omanization rules, which involve hiring a percentage of Omani employees.

Oman offers various incentives, such as tax exemptions and free trade zones, making it an attractive destination for foreign entrepreneurs. By following the right procedures and working with local consultants, you can successfully establish your business in Oman.
